What year was the Ford truck on Sanford and Son? What became of it?

—Bill Glunt, Tyrone, Pa.

The red 1951 Ford F-100 belongs to the Dimmitt family of Argos, Ind., which owns Dimmitt's Auto Salvage, and the vehicle was a star in their hometown's 4th of July parade last year. "Dad purchased it because he always loved the Sanford and Son show," says Steve Dimmitt about his late father, who was a junk dealer just like Fred Sanford (played by Redd Foxx). "He bought it in 1987 from William Mills in Elkhart, Ind., who had bought it from a charity auction" in Las Vegas. The 1970s series reruns on TV Land.
